Output 21691780bddcdd470d4d82d487a23d6111fe7a8807305af56071ddaf9b9cb30d:1

value
64488994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575bc3279ded849ace8fc43f515ba88d5791c1a2 OP_EQUAL
address
MFs4wsqvZfdYTEEjwe3UTcuhvgtL5mzwwm
transaction
21691780bddcdd470d4d82d487a23d6111fe7a8807305af56071ddaf9b9cb30d
spent
true